St. Stephen's Cathedral

St. Stephen's Cathedral (Stephansdom) in Vienna is the Roman Catholic mother church of the Archdiocese of Vienna and the city's principal Gothic landmark. Built of limestone, it combines Romanesque west towers with an elaborately carved Gothic south tower and a large steep roof covered in patterned glazed tiles. The building contains multiple naves, a Gothic choir, bell belfries and interior tombs and pulpits.

As it stood in 1474

The shape it held in its prime.

A large limestone Gothic cathedral with a very tall, open-traceried south spire and an asymmetrical shorter north tower capped in a Renaissance roof. The steep, long roof is covered in multicoloured glazed tiles arranged in bold chevron patterns and a mosaic double-headed eagle above the choir. Pointed-arch windows, flying buttresses, carved portals and clustered pinnacles puncture the façades; the west face retains older square Romanesque towers. Scale dominates the surrounding square.
